SC32 - Fire and Emergency Management
Summary
Fires and emergencies present a risk to everyone, and the ability to respond effectively and rapidly to them is a major factor in preventing injury and loss.
This code addresses at a high level site emergency planning requiring each site documents, tests and routinely reviews the content of emergency plans.
The code addresses all aspects of Fire Management at STFC sites: installation and maintenance of fire detection systems; provision of competent advice by Fire Safety Advisors and SHE Group; management of changes to the building fabric; the management of hot work; and most importantly the response expected of everyone in the event of a fire alarm. The code also outline10 basic rules for fire Safety in the STFC – keeping you and everyone else safe.
The code also provides very specific technical guidance for those involved with building construction or renovation work.
